Transaction 30510065fffbf9eb55ef15c23f201c2bcd7aad7a8d2d9ba09e313b85191666dd
1 Input
1 Output
-
30510065fffbf9eb55ef15c23f201c2bcd7aad7a8d2d9ba09e313b85191666dd:0
- value
- 17373112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75c53404cbf5c3d502af03ab22b17b32075f0c01 OP_EQUAL
- address
- MJdsXnw8FzLZZ8i81bLpfz2AsXT1emq7RR